The Cabinet Committee on Government Purchase (CCGP) on Wednesday approved separate proposals for procuring one cargo LNG and 70,000 tonnes of fertiliser to meet the growing demands of the country.

The approval came from the 17th meeting of the CCGP this year held at the Cabinet Division Conference Room at Bangladesh Secretariat, reports BSS.

Briefing reporters after the meeting, Cabinet Division Secretary (coordination and reforms) Md Mahmudul Hossain Khan said a total of nine proposals were approved Wednesday.

He informed that following a proposal from the Energy and Mineral Resources Division, Petrobangla would procure one cargo LNG from M/S Excelerate Energy, LP, United States with around Tk 609.28 crore where per MMBtu LNG would cost $13.55.

Hossain said following two separate proposals from the Ministry of Agriculture, Bangladesh Agricultural Development Corporation (BADC) would procure 40,000 tonnes of DAP fertiliser from MA'ADEN, Saudi Arabia under a state-level agreement with around Tk 246.85 crore where per tonne fertiliser would cost $523.

In another approved proposal, the BADC would import 30,000 tonnes of MOP fertiliser under a state-level agreement from JSC Foreign Economic Corporation, Prodintorg, Russia with around Tk 97.52 crore where per tonne of fertiliser would cost $275.50.

In response to another proposal from the Energy and Mineral Resources Division, the day's CCGP meeting approved the probable signing of a draft agreement between Sylhet Gas Fields Limited (SGFL) and Sinopec International Petroleum Service Corporation, China with around Tk 444.85 crore.

Apart from approving another proposal from the Road Transport and Highways Division, the meeting also gave approval to four cost variation proposals from different ministries.
